#VU69938 Insufficient Logging in FortiSandbox


Published: 2022-12-06

Vulnerability identifier: #VU69938

Vulnerability risk: Medium

CVSSv3.1: 4.2 [CVSS:3.1/AV:N/AC:H/PR:N/UI:N/S:U/C:L/I:L/A:N/E:U/RL:O/RC:C]

CVE-ID: CVE-2022-30305

CWE-ID: CWE-778

Exploitation vector: Network

Exploit availability: No

Vulnerable software:
FortiSandbox
Server applications / DLP, anti-spam, sniffers

Vendor: Fortinet, Inc

Description

The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to perform a brute-force attack.

The vulnerability exists due to an error within the logging system implementation. A remote non-authenticated attacker can repeatedly enter incorrect credentials without causing a log entry, and with no limit on the number of failed authentication attempts.

Mitigation
Install updates from vendor's website.

Vulnerable software versions

FortiSandbox: 3.1.0 - 4.0.2
